IBM MQ Light V1.0 simplifies development of scalable and responsive applications on premise or in the cloud

Description |
IBM MQ Light V1.0 makes it easy for developers to incorporate asynchronous messaging into their applications to help make them responsive and more scalable. Applications developed with IBM MQ Light can be deployed against a number of different IBM messaging offerings to give users the flexibility to choose the appropriate messaging server without having to re-write the application code. Applications can be deployed with IBM MQ Light for quick and simple deployments that give the user complete control. Applications can also be deployed into the IBM Bluemix Cloud by using the IBM MQ Light for Bluemix messaging service to take advantage of a completely managed cloud service. IBM plans for them to be deployed using IBM MQ. For details on the previously published statement of direction, refer to Software Announcement 214-177, dated April 22, 2014.
IBM MQ Light makes it easy to set up a development environment because developers can unzip IBM MQ Light to anywhere appropriate on their file system. There are no prerequisites. Users can be up and running instantly by using the single start script. For new users, there are examples and tutorials to demonstrate how applications can use messaging to easily scale and become more responsive. For existing users, once stated, there is no administration so they can write their application code.
The IBM MQ Light API makes constructing an application easy, and the growing range of languages supported allows developers to use the appropriate language for each component. IBM MQ Light delivers a common messaging model that connects all components together. The API that is based on the open AMQP1.0 standard makes it easy for users to extend the existing APIs or create new APIs in other programming languages.
The IBM MQ Light user interface provides a user with a comprehensive insight of not only what is happening within IBM MQ Light, but also what has previously happened and what applications are connected to it. This information is vital to help developers create loosely coupled applications by helping them understand what data is flowing and has previously flowed between components, as well as where each of the messages has been distributed.

Product positioning |
The IBM MQ family of messaging transports provides a messaging backbone with a range of capabilities for the enterprise, both intercompany and intracompany. The objective of the IBM MQ brand is to offer a comprehensive suite of seamless, interconnected transport protocols, and quality-of-service levels:
- IBM MQ Server, the core of application integration, is a highly effective messaging backbone for service-oriented architecture (SOA) connectivity, as the universal, multipurpose data transport. It connects virtually any commercial IT system, with support for more than 80 platform configurations. MQ includes a choice of APIs and interoperates with the Java Message Service (JMS) messaging services embedded in WebSphere® Application Server. This extends its reach to non-Java Enterprise Edition (JEE) environments. WebSphere MQ is a flexible and scalable connectivity solution that can grow incrementally with changing business needs.
- IBM MQ can be enhanced through additional capabilities delivered with the product. It provides managed file transfer and end-to-end message encryption and security, and access to mobile and remotely connected physical devices.
- WebSphere MQ Managed File Transfer adds file-specific features to the WebSphere MQ transport. It delivers a managed file transfer solution that can enable the movement of files between IT systems with reliability and without the need for programming. This is available with additional entitlement or as a part of IBM MQ Advanced entitlement.
- IBM MQ Advanced Message Security expands the security offered by IBM MQ with end-to-end data protection for applications and it can be deployed to existing production environments without changes to existing IBM MQ applications. IBM MQ Advanced Message Security is available with additional entitlement or as a part of IBM MQ Advanced entitlement.
- IBM MQ Telemetry extends IBM MQ through clients using Message Queue Telemetry Transport (MQTT), which is a standard, lightweight connectivity protocol. This enables connected physical devices and mobile devices, which may be restricted by bandwidth and power consumption, to exchange information with IBM MQ. Included as a part of MQ Advanced entitlement, but it requires separate entitlement if no IBM MQ Advanced licenses are owned.
- IBM MQ Advanced can be purchased as a single part number to provide entitlement to IBM MQ, WebSphere MQ Managed File Transfer Service, IBM MQ Advanced Message Security, and IBM MQ Telemetry for deployment on distributed systems.
- WebSphere MQ for z/OS® exploits the platform-specific capabilities of the IBM System z® platform to deliver a messaging powerhouse.
- WebSphere MQ Advanced for z/OS can be purchased in one transaction for entitlement to WebSphere MQ File Transfer Edition for z/OS and WebSphere MQ Advanced Message Security for z/OS. It requires separate entitlement for WebSphere MQ for z/OS.

Technical information |
Specified operating environment
Hardware requirements
For Linux: Linux for System x® (64-bit): AMD64, x86-64, and compatible processors
For Windows: x86-64 (also known as x64) technology-compatible PC hardware
Software requirements
Minimum software requirements
For Linux operating system
-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) Server 6 Server Update 3 (x86-64)
- Ubuntu 12.04 LTS (x86-64)
For Windows operating system
- Windows Server 2008 Standard Edition (x86-64)
- Windows 7 SP1 Professional, (x86-64)
Supported web browsers
- Mozilla Firefox (24 or higher)
- Microsoft Internet Explorer (10 or higher)
- Google Chrome (34 or higher)
- Apple Safari (5.1 or higher)

Install
Install is a unit of measure by which the program can be licensed. An install is an installed copy of the program on a physical or virtual disk made available to be executed on a computer. Licensee must obtain an entitlement for each install of the program.
Simultaneous Session
Simultaneous Session is a unit of measure by which the Program can be licensed. A session is an active file transfer or other active communications connection between the Program running on one physical or virtual computer and any software running on another physical or virtual computer. Licensee must obtain entitlements sufficient to cover the highest number of sessions that are or have been simultaneously in existence across all instances or copies of the Program.
